The Vatican has announced that Pope Francis is being treated for a “complex clinical situation” involving a polymicrobial infection in his respiratory tract, leading to a change in his treatment at Rome’s Gemelli hospital. The 88-year-old pontiff had been experiencing bronchitis symptoms before his hospitalization, with tests revealing a need for ongoing hospitalization. The Pope’s scheduled events, including his weekly general audience, have been cancelled, and updates on his condition are expected to be provided later on Monday.

Canada soccer coach claims Vancouver Whitecaps players were 'poisoned' during cup final trip to Mexico
Canada men's national team coach Jesse Marsch expressed his outrage regarding the Vancouver Whitecaps players feeling "poisoned" during their trip to Mexico for the CONCACAF Champions Cup final. In contrast, Whitecaps head coach Jesper Sorensen dismissed the notion that someone intentionally made his team sick.
